Write a C++ function using recursion that returns the Greatest Common Divisor of two integers. The greatest common divisor (gcd) of two integers, which are not zero, is the largest positive inteteger that divides each of the integers. The code should follow the exact function declaration: int GCD(int number1, int number2);
Q: Write a program that computes the Greatest Common Factor for any given two values. The user should…
A: #include <iostream> using namespace std; int GCF(int n, int m){ if(m<=n &&…
Q: Write a recursive C++ function, sumdigits, which will accept a positive integer and calculate and…
A: By given problem,if Input of sumdigits function is : 123456 then Output is : 1+2+3+4+5+6 = 21…
Q: Write a C++ function that accepts a double typed number and return back the fractional part of the…
A: C++ Code for as par your requirements: it prints only fractional parts. #include <iostream>…
Q: Write a program in C++ using libraries. Write a function that allows case-insensitive comparison of…
A: String: String is nothing but a sequence of characters.
Q: Write a C program that creates a security access code from a social security number entered by a…
A: // stdio.h is the C standard library it is a header file stdio.h which stands for standard…
Q: Write a c++ recursive function that takes two integers n and k, and prints all binary strings that…
A: Answer: Algorithms: we have create a function name func and passed the arguments string and one for…
Q: Write a recursive function that returns a value of 1 if its string argument is a palindrome and zero…
A: Python code to check whether the string is palindrome or not Code def sentencePalindrome (s):…
Q: Write a C function which takes two positive integers n and k from the user. Then represent the…
A: Program: #include <stdio.h> //fucntion nSystemint nSystem(int n, int k){ //switch n which is…
Q: Based on the function definition below, write a complete C program with implementation of functions:…
A: Solution :
Q: make a c++ function that can utilize recursion that will add the n terms of an ar1thmetic. make this…
A: add(a, b, n) if(n == 0) return 0 else return a + add(a+b, b,…
Q: in c++ Convert the following function to one that uses recursion. void sign(int n) { while (n> 0)…
A: The given program snippet is: void sign(int n) { while (n>0) cout <<"No Parking\n"; n--; }…
Q: write a recursive function named choose (int n,int k) that will compute and return the value of the…
A: Define header files <iostream> and <string> for io and string operations, respectively.…
Q: Each of the following recursive function definitions contains an error. Briefly but fully and…
A: Below i have answered:
Q: Write C++ program. Write a recursive function to print integers from a given number N to 0. When…
A:
Q: Create a recursive function that simulates the range function. For example: Enter the range…
A: The code is given below.
Q: What type of recursive function do you think would be more difficult to debug; one that uses direct…
A: Indirect recursion is more difficult to trace and debug than direct recursion. • In direct…
Q: Write a C++ recursive function PrintPattern3 to print following pattern using recursion. No loops…
A: Algorithm: Start print_space( int n){ if (n>0) print space print_space( int n-1) }…
Q: Write a recursive function definition in C that will calculate the sum of the first n odd integers…
A: Here is your recursive program in C , with well defined comments!
Q: Write a recursive function in c++that receives an integer consisting of any number of digits. Your…
A: Please find the answer below :
Q: Write a recursive findSum function which returns the sum of all integers between (and including) two…
A: Program Planning:- To calculate the sum of all integers presents within a specifically defined…
Q: Write a recursive C function that returns the uppercase letters of the string named str by storing…
A: Write a recursive C function that returns the uppercase letters of the string named str by storing…
Q: Write a program that asks a number “N” from user. Write a function that takes this number “N”, then…
A: Introduction of Program: The C program takes the value of N from the user and then the program…
Q: Write a recursive function in C that can find out sum of the digits of given number. Do not use any…
A: C program to find out sum of the digits of the given number. Call the function to find out sum of…
Q: 1. Write a recursive function to calculate the factorial of a given number. 2. Write a C program to…
A: 1. Algorithm: Start Read a number n Implement a function named fact() which takes n as argument…
Q: In C++, Write a program of multiply two matrices without using functions?
A: Given: In C++, Write a program of multiply two matrices without using functions?
Q: What are the advantages and disadvantages of using recursive functions? Write a program to find…
A: Recursion : is a situation where a function calls itself from its body. Advantages are : 1.…
Q: Write a recursive function rec_string that produces the output shown below for the corresponding…
A: Program Algorithm-STARTStep1: Define the rec_string method.Step2: Compare the length of string to…
Q: In C++ Consider the following recursive function (Chapter 17, #9, modified) void recFun(int x)…
A: Given: In C++ Consider the following recursive function (Chapter 17, #9, modified) How can the…
Q: Write a function in C++ that takes two strings as parameters and return a boolean value. Function…
A: Get the lengths Get the remainders to check whether lengths are even or odd Check whether remainders…
Q: Write a recursive C++ function "accept" that takes a string and returns true if and only if it…
A: Code:- #include <iostream> using namespace std; bool accept(string input){ int xin = -1;…
Q: Write a program that asks the user to enter a binary string and you must use this binary string as…
A: Algorithm: Start Read a binary string Implement a recursive method binary_to_decimal_1() which takes…
Q: A 5-digit positive integer is entered through the keyboard, write a function to…
A: Given :- A 5-digit positive integer is entered through the keyboard, write a function to…
Q: Consider the following recursive function: void recurse(int num) { if (num == 0)…
A: EXPLANATION: “Yes”, the given call recurse (-2) us a valid call. This calls the recurse function…
Q: Write a C program that uses the function compareFour and main to determine the largest of four…
A: #include <stdio.h> int max_of_four(double a,double b, double c, double d){{ if (a > b) {…
Q: 2) Write the definition of a recursive function named find that is passed a cstring and a char and…
A: Given: C++ Note: Implementation has to be recursive. Try not using loops while implementing, Meaning…
Q: Write a C++ program that checks if a number is Palindrome (use recursive function as you code). A…
A: Start define a recursive function rev that calculates reverse input integer number if reverse is…
Q: 1. You are to create a well-formed Python recursive function (i.e, there must be a stopping/base…
A: Tracing a function and keep tracking its memory: The below python program computes the sum of…
Q: Write a recursive C function that returns the capital letters of a string str. The prototype of…
A: In step 2, you will the C code.In step 3, you can see the sample output.In step 4, you will get the…
Q: Write a program in c++ to calculate the power of a number using resursion. Call the function power…
A: Given that, it is asking for program to calculate power of a number using recursion in c++ language.…
Q: language: Python Problem: Write a recursive function reverse(sentence) for reversing a…
A: Recursive function is a function that calls itself repeatedly until condition will be false Here…
Q: Write a function in c called recursively_reverse_string() that accepts a pointer to a string as a…
A: Program code: //include the required header files #include <stdio.h> #include<stdlib.h>…
Q: Write a recursive function definition in C that will calculate the sum of the first n odd integers…
A: Problem statement:- C Program to find the sum of odd numbers using recursion. Program input:…
Q: A C++ program to find all roads on which object A can move to object B and mark with an asterisk…
A:
Q: Write a program in C++ using a function to Add, subtract and Multiply matrices. Your program should…
A: Before implementing Matrix arithmetic operations in C++, we must be aware of how different…
Q: 2) Write the definition of a recursive function named find that is passed a c-string and a char and…
A: GIVEN:
Write a C++ function using recursion that returns the Greatest Common Divisor of two integers. The greatest common divisor (gcd) of two integers, which are not zero, is the largest positive inteteger that divides each of the integers. The code should follow the exact function declaration:
int GCD(int number1, int number2);
Trending now
This is a popular solution!
Step by step
Solved in 3 steps with 1 images
- (Numerical) Write a program that tests the effectiveness of the rand() library function. Start by initializing 10 counters to 0, and then generate a large number of pseudorandom integers between 0 and 9. Each time a 0 occurs, increment the variable you have designated as the zero counter; when a 1 occurs, increment the counter variable that’s keeping count of the 1s that occur; and so on. Finally, display the number of 0s, 1s, 2s, and so on that occurred and the percentage of the time they occurred.C Programming Problem : Write a C program with a function that takes an integer value (1 <- integer value < 9999) and returns the number with its digits reversed. For example, given the number 6798, the function should return 8976. Those two- original number and reversed number- numbers will pass to another function as parameters and calculate their sum. The program should use the function reverseDigits to reverse the digits and SumOriginalReverse to calculate their sum. Your output should appear in the following format: Output reverse digiS 4321 Main Enter a number between 1 and 9999: 6798 The number with its digits reversed is: 8976 6798 + 8976 - 15774 12.34 JomoriginalRevers Enter a number between I and 9999: 6655 The number with its digits reversed is: 5566 6655 + 5566 = 12221 Enter a number between 1 and 9999: 8 The number with its digits reversed is: 8 8 + 8 = 16 Enter a number between 1 and 9999: 123 The number with its digits reversed is: 321 123 + 321 = 444 Enter a number…Computer Science In C++ use the following STL algorithms: reverse, rotate, and shuffle. Write versions of these functions using the same parameters as the original functions but using your own definition of the function body. Use each function at least three different times in a test program to make sure the function operates properly. The data sets you use for testing should contain at least twenty elements
- Write a C++ function weird_sum that takes two integer parameters, n1 and n2. The function returns the sum of n1 and n2, as long as their sum is not a multiple of 13. If their sum is a multiple of 13, the function returns 3 less than the sum of n1 and n2.C Program: An integer number is said to be a perfect number if its factors, including 1 (but not the number itself), sum to the number. For example, 6 is a perfect number because 6 = 1 + 2 + 3. I have written a function called isPerfect (see below), that determines whether parameter passed to the function is a perfect number. Use this function in a C program that determines and prints all the perfect numbers between 1 and 1000. Print the factors of each perfect number to confirm that the number is indeed perfect. // isPerfect returns true if value is perfect integer, // i.e., if value is equal to sum of its factors int isPerfect(int value) { int factorSum = 1; // current sum of factors // loop through possible factor values for (int i = 2; i <= value / 2; ++i) { // if i is factor if (value % i == 0) { factorSum += i; // add to sum } } // return true if value is equal to sum of factors if (factorSum == value) { return…Write a c++ program: Write a function named convertToLowestTerms that inputs two integer parameters by reference named numerator and denominator. The function should treat these variables as a fraction and reduce them to lowest terms. For example, if numerator is 20 and denominator is 60, then the function should change the variables to 1 and 3, respectively. This will require finding the greatest common divisor for the numerator and denominator then dividing both variables by that number. If the denominator is zero, the function should return false, otherwise the function should return true. Write a driver program that uses convertToLowestTerms to reduce and output several fractions.
- Problem: Recursive Power Method Design a python function that uses recursion to raise a number to a power. The function should accept two arguments: the number to be raised, and the exponent. Assume the exponent is a nonnegative integer. Write the main() function to input the required parameters as shown in thesample input/output. Sample Output:Average number of words per line: 26.0Enter a number: 2Enter a positive whole number between 1 and 100: 102.0 raised to the power of 10 is 1,024.00IN C++ Write a program that computes the Greatest Common Factor for any given two values. The user should be able to enter as many values (sets of two) as needed. The program should do the following: 1. Allow the user to enter as many values as needed. 2. After the user enters all the values, the program displays each pair of values and the GCF. 3. The function to find GCF must be a recursive function. Here is the definition that you must use: GCF (n,m) = m if mC++ Programming: Write a recursive function, sumDigits, that takes an integer as a parameter and returns the sum of the digits of the integer. Also, write a program to test your function. Your program should prompt the user for an integer and output the results to the console.
- 1. Write a recursive function that takes a string as an input and returns the reverse of the string. 2.Write a recursive function rec_string that produces the output shown below for the corresponding function calls. Write a main function to test the function. Method call rec_string(‘abcde’), will produce the following output: *ede cde bcde abcde Method call rec_string(‘abc’), will produce the following output: *cbc abc 3. Write a recursive function for Euclid's algorithm to find the greatest common divisor (gcd) of two positive integers. gcd is the largest integer that divides evenly into both of them. For example, the gcd(102, 68) = 34. You may recall learning about the greatest common divisor when you learned to reduce fractions. For example, we can simplify 68/102 to 2/3 by dividing both numerator and denominator by 34, their gcd. Finding the gcd of huge numbers is an important problem that arises in many commercial applications. We can efficiently compute the gcd using the…Consider the following recursive function. What does it calculate in terms of x, y, and z? 01: Private Function CalcRecurse(ByVal x As Integer, ByVal y As Integer, ByVal z As Integer) As Integer 02: If x <= 1 Then 'Assume that CalcRecurse always starts with x > 1 03: Return y 04: Else 05: Return z + CalcRecurse(x - 1, y, z) 06: End If 07: End FunctionWrite a recursive function definition for the following function: int squares(int n); //Precondition: n >= 1 //Returns the sum of the squares of numbers 1 through n. For example, squares(3) returns 14 because 12 + 22 + 32 is 14.